I think Tennessee's downfall is more surprising. A team that went 13-3 with Kerry Collins at QB is bound to come off of cloud 9...but to the tune of 0-6 is very surprising. Injuries in their secondary have killed them, and Fisher stuck with Collins too long because of his lack of trust in Vince Young (They cut Patrick Ramsey on October 4th to make room for more CBs).
